Football fall camp is starting up around the SEC, but there’s still basketball news to pass along. Alabama and Kentucky both picked up 4-star commitments Thursday.

Mississippi shooting guard Jaylen Forbes announced his commitment to the Crimson Tide via his Twitter account Thursday. The Florence product measures 6-5, 190 pounds and is rated the No. 100 overall recruit, No. 17 shooting guard and No. 2 player out of Mississippi on the 247Sports Composite.

Forbes is the second commitment in Avery Johnson’s 2019 class, which currently has Composite rankings of No. 2 in the SEC and No. 7 nationally.

Kentucky picked up a commitment from 4-star small forward Dontaie Allen. A product of the Bluegrass State in Pendleton County, Allen measures 6-6, 185 pounds. His Composite rankings are No. 145 overall recruit, No. 35 small forward and No. 3 recruit in the state of Kentucky. He also made his announcement on Twitter.

Allen joins 5-star recruit Tyrese Maxey in the Wildcats’ 2019 class, which is ranked No. 1 in the SEC and No. 5 nationally on Composite.
